The MEED Insight Mena Rail and Metro Projects report provides a complete breakdown of the rail and metro projects market and quantifies spending and investment in the rail sector by country. The report analyses the challenges facing the rail sector and the financing methods being used for rail projects across the region.In addition to the exclusive forecast for projects spending, the research report also ranks and profiles the key clients.
